Adult Cantharids may generally be distinguished from those of other families by the following: weakly sclerotized and soft-bodied with the head mostly exposed in front of the pronotum, 11-segmented and usually filiform antennae but in some groups they are pectinate or flabellate, labrum membranous and often obscured by the clypeus. WebDec 20, 2024 · Tytthonyx milleri Ivie, Fanti, and Ferreira, new species (Cantharidae, Tytthonyxini) is described from Miocene Dominican amber. The new species is compared with the other two described fossil taxa of the genus, as well as two additional, undescribed Dominican amber cantharid species, and their morphology is discussed. WebJan 1, 2024 · Our research describes a new fossil soldier beetle, Archaeomalthodes rosetta gen. et sp. nov. sharing many diagnostic characters with the extant cantharids to support its placement in the family Cantharidae, subfamily Malthininae, and tribe Malthodini.
